[0031] like figure 1 As shown, the embodiment provides a kind of MIDI rhythm pattern recognition method, comprises the following steps:

[0032] S101 , splitting the MIDI segment into a low range and a middle and high range according to the distribution of pitch thresholds.

[0033] The MIDI segment may generally be a MIDI performance segment of a textured instrument (such as a percussion instrument such as a piano, a plucked string instrument such as a guitar, or an electronic synthesizer). Abstract

The invention discloses an MIDI rhythm type identification method. The method comprises the steps: splitting an MIDI fragment into a bass area and a middle-high pitch area according to voice thresholddistribution; dividing the MIDI fragment into N units according to a certain unit length, dividing the time length corresponding to each unit into a plurality of time steps, and respectively countingthe occurrence frequency of notes of each time step in a bass region and a middle-high pitch region; aiming at the bass zone and the middle-high pitch zone, respectively counting the average frequency of notes appearing on the time steps corresponding to the N units, wherein a sequence formed by the average frequency according to time steps represents rhythmic characteristics. The invention alsodiscloses a rhythm type-based music style determination method and a rhythm type-based playing mode determination method. The three methods are simple, and a new thought is provided for automatic composition and automatic accompaniment.

Description

technical field [0001] The invention belongs to the field of MIDI music, and in particular relates to a MIDI rhythm type recognition method, a rhythm type-based music style determination method and a performance method determination method. Background technique [0002] The rhythmic pattern of music generally refers to the regular repetition of melody, texture, drums and other parts that give people a sense of music. In jazz, it can be thought of as the quality of a continuously repeating rhythmic unit that results from the interplay of music played by the rhythm section of the band (for example, drums, electric bass or double bass, guitar, and keyboards) . Rhythmic patterns are an important feature of popular music and can be found in many genres, including salsa, funk, rock, fusion, and soul music.
